Answer first

Start with cases, coding, and assumptions before the main coefficient table

Confirm the analyzed sample, missing-data rules, variable coding, reference categories, weights, filters, and model specification. Then read descriptives, diagnostics, model fit, estimates with intervals, and sensitivity checks.

For cluster analysis, interpret the scaling, distance measure, algorithm, agglomeration or model summary, chosen number of clusters, profiles, stability, and external usefulness. Clusters are exploratory groups, not naturally true labels.

A method you can reuse

Use one five-pass SPSS reading workflow

Pass one checks whether SPSS analyzed the intended cases and variables. Pass two checks descriptives and data quality. Pass three reviews assumptions and diagnostics. Pass four interprets estimates and fit. Pass five translates results into the research question and limitations.

Save syntax and output together. Menu clicks without syntax make it difficult to reproduce filters, recodes, reference categories, and options.

01

Read warnings and case processing

Record exclusions, missing cases, convergence warnings, empty cells, and analyzed n.

02

Confirm coding and descriptives

Check value labels, direction, plausible ranges, group counts, means, SDs, and distributions.

03

Review method-specific diagnostics

Examples include residuals, Levene’s test, collinearity, KMO, communalities, reliability items, scaling, or cluster stability.

04

Interpret estimates with uncertainty

Use coefficients, mean differences, odds ratios, loadings, or cluster profiles with intervals and substantive units where available.

05

Write one claim per table

State what the table answers, the supporting values, and what it does not establish.

Worked from start to finish

Cluster analysis SPSS output interpretation

A fictional hierarchical cluster analysis uses four standardized study-behavior variables.

Preparation:
• Variables converted to z scores because their raw scales differ
• Squared Euclidean distance and Ward linkage selected

Output reading:
1. Proximity matrix checked for extreme or duplicate cases
2. Agglomeration schedule shows a large coefficient jump from 3 to 2 clusters
3. Dendrogram supports examining 3 clusters
4. Saved 3-cluster membership is profiled on original variables
5. Cluster solution is rerun after changing case order and checked in a holdout sample

Profiles:
Cluster 1: frequent short review and practice
Cluster 2: low study frequency across measures
Cluster 3: long sessions concentrated near exams

Result: The three-cluster solution is treated as a tentative, interpretable summary that still requires stability and external validation.

A dendrogram does not prove the correct number of real groups. The choice combines statistical structure, interpretability, stability, and the purpose of the analysis.

Labels such as “effective students” can overstate the data. Use descriptive names tied to measured variables and avoid turning clusters into diagnoses or identities.

Common SPSS tables and the first question to ask

The table name is less important than the role it plays in the analysis.

Output First question Common overreach
Case Processing Summary Which cases were analyzed and why were others missing? Assuming the original sample size was used
Descriptives Are counts, centers, spreads, and ranges plausible? Skipping data errors because the final model ran
Levene’s Test What variance assumption is being assessed for this model? Treating it as a universal pass or fail gate
ANOVA table What model variation is compared with residual variation? Claiming it identifies every group difference
Coefficients or Variables in Equation What is the scale, coding, estimate, and interval? Reading Sig. without interpreting B or Exp(B)
Cluster output How were variables scaled and clusters selected and validated? Treating exploratory clusters as true categories

Factor analysis output requires a different chain: factorability, extraction method, number of factors, rotation, loadings, cross-loadings, communalities, and theoretical coherence. A loading cutoff alone does not establish a valid scale.

Reliability output also needs care. A high alpha can reflect many redundant items and does not prove unidimensionality or validity. Read item wording, inter-item structure, and the measurement model.

Failure-mode review

Common problems and how to repair them

Searching only the Sig. column

Interpret the estimate, uncertainty, design, coding, assumptions, and practical meaning first.

Ignoring warnings and excluded cases

Warnings can invalidate later tables. Explain missingness and convergence before reporting results.

Treating every default as appropriate

Document why the method, options, contrasts, rotation, distance, or linkage fit the question.

Copying raw SPSS tables into a paper

Create a clear publication table with needed estimates, labels, notes, and precision, then verify it against the output.

Questions students ask

Frequently asked questions

How do I start interpreting SPSS output?

Begin with warnings, case processing, missing data, filters, coding, and descriptives before reading the main test or coefficient table.

What does Sig. mean in SPSS?

It is the reported p-value for a specified test under the model. It does not show effect size, importance, validity, or causation.

How do I interpret cluster analysis output?

Explain scaling, distance, algorithm, cluster-number choice, profiles, stability, validation, and the exploratory nature of the solution.

Should I include every SPSS table in my paper?

No. Report the tables needed to answer the question and support diagnostics, with clear labels and notes.

Why should I save SPSS syntax?

Syntax records transformations, filters, options, models, and output requests, making the analysis auditable and reproducible.
